公安系统本体构建与SPARQL查询应用

需积分: 0 7 下载量 115 浏览量 更新于2024-08-06 收藏 2.58MB PDF 举报
"本体的构建-smsckf公式推导(与代码一致),关联数据" 在信息技术领域,本体的构建对于数据管理和信息共享至关重要。本体是一种形式化的语义网络,它定义了领域内的概念、关系以及这些概念和关系的规则,用于描述和组织特定领域内的知识。在“本体的构建-smsckf公式推导”这个主题中,重点讨论了如何采用面向应用的自底向上方法来构建本体,特别是针对公安信息系统的本体架构。 公安信息系统本体主要由领域本体、业务本体和任务本体构成。领域本体涵盖了案件、涉案物品、犯罪证据、现场痕迹和涉案人员等核心概念,同时包含了高层概念如时间、地点、人员、机构和物品。业务本体则是在领域本体的指导下,与各个具体的业务系统相对应,用于标准化数据库的元数据描述,使SPARQL查询语句能自动生成,并将查询结果转换成标准格式。任务本体描述的是诸如综合查询、比对和统计等基本操作的序列。 本体的使用能够解决业务系统异构性的问题,即便数据结构、录入和查询方式不同,同警种相同业务的系统在语义层面上仍然可以共享和互操作。通过映射和互操作,不同警种或不同业务的系统间也能实现数据关联共享。在这里,选用Prato作为本体构建工具,利用W3C推荐的OWL(Web Ontology Language)进行建模。 关联数据是语义万维网的关键技术之一,它强调数据的开放性和链接性,旨在消除信息孤岛,确保数据的一致性和完整性。在公安情报研判系统中,关联数据的应用有助于整合和共享来自多个业务系统的异构数据。遵循W3C的关联数据原则,通过建立统一数据模型,采用RDF(Resource Description Framework)描述数据,利用工具如Scones进行命名实体提取,Silk进行链接发现,RDFizer进行数据转换,从而设计出适用于公安系统的关联数据模型。这样的模型能够与现有业务系统、数据仓库、分析工具和人机界面有效结合,实现情报研判工作的自动化或半自动化。 通过本体和关联数据的结合,公安系统能够提高信息共享和深度挖掘的效率,更好地服务于实战需求,提升公安信息化水平。